11.3.2
Befehle nach dem Profil S-7.4/S-7.5
11.3.2.1
Übersicht über die Befehle
siehe
Befehl
Seite
WR_74_75_PARAM
Seite 87
RD_74_75_PARAM
Seite 88
RD_74_75_ID
Seite 88
RD_74_DIAG
Seite 89
11.3.2.2
WR_74_75_PARAM
Mit dieser Funktion wird der Parameterstring eines Slaves nach Profil S-7.4 ge-
schrieben oder die Übertragung mit einem Slave nach Profil S-7.5 gestartet. Han-
delt es sich um einen Slave nach dem Profil S-7.5, so müssen Daten in dem
Sendepuffer in genau der gleichen Form eingetragen werden, wie sie über AS-i
gesendet werden sollen.
Da der String länger als die Kommandoschnittstelle sein kann, wird er zuerst in
Stücken in einen Puffer geschrieben und dann erst zum Slave übertragen.
n sei die Länge des Teilstrings, der ab Index i in den Puffer geschrieben werden
soll.
Wenn i ≡ 0 ist, wird der String zum Slave übertragen.
Byte
1
2
3
4
5
6
...
n+5
Byte
1
2
Zumutbare Änderungen aufgrund technischer Verbesserungen vorbehalten.
Pepperl+Fuchs GmbH · 68301 Mannheim · Telefon (06 21) 7 76-11 11 · Telefax (06 21) 7 76 27-11 11 · Internet http://www.pepperl-fuchs.com
Wert Bedeutung
5A
5B
5C
5D
7
6
5
2
2
2
T
–
7
6
5
2
2
2
T
AS-i DeviceNet-Gateway
Kommandoschnittstelle
Werte für Befehl
Write S-7.4/S-7.5-slave parameter
16
Read S-7.4/S-7.5-slave parameter
16
Read S-7.4/S-7.5-slave ID string
16
Read S-7.4/S-7.5-slave diagnosis
16
string
Anfrage
4
3
2
2
5A
16
Kreis
Slaveadresse
i
n
Pufferbyte i
...
Pufferbyte i+n-1
Antwort
4
3
2
2
5A
16
Ergebnis
Req
Len
≥6
4
4
4
2
1
2
2
2
1
2
2
Copyright Pepperl+Fuchs, Printed in Germany
Res
Len
2
≥3
≥3
≥3
0
2
0
2
87